Forceps, scissors, scalpels, and tweezers are instruments used in the handling of precision equipment in experiments and R&D in cleanrooms. There are disposable types to prevent contamination for use in research and development and cleanrooms. Also, non-magnetic and acid resistant tools can be selected according to the application to be used. Forceps are instruments for grasping tissue and are used for taking samples. A scissor is an auxiliary tool for experiments, and the type of cutting edge varies depending on the application, available in double, single, double cusps, etc. Scalpels are used for slicing gels, etc. for dissection and DNA purification. Tweezers are tools that work by pinching small objects, and the tip of the tweezers has a different shape according to the pinched object, with some that use the pull force of a vacuum.
